Port Edward Primary school held its annual Foundation Phase fun day. Grades 1 – 3 learners from schools along the South Coast enjoyed a busy morning of hockey, soccer and mini-rugby matches last Saturday.

Various food stalls and games were on the go, and the school was filled with excitement and activity. Well done to all the young players and many thanks to the visiting schools, coaches and parents for supporting the fun day.
Special thanks to the amazing, generous Port Edward community – to the many parents who offered assistance on the day, as well as to the numerous individuals and businesses who donated prizes and food items. The fundraiser was a great success thanks to their willingness to help and contribute.
